Janhvi Kapoor recently opened up on Raj Shamani’s podcast about the immense emotional weight of her mother’s legacy. She reflected on the harsh public scrutiny Sridevi endured, noting that being frequently labeled a 'homewrecker' left a deep, lasting impact on her family. Speaking on the tragedy of her mother’s passing, Janhvi described it as her 'biggest trauma', made even more difficult by having to grieve in the public eye. She admitted to constantly trying to escape the 'inner turmoil' and unresolved feelings that still linger years later.
Janhvi shared that the loss felt like losing both parents at once. She explained that her father, Boney Kapoor, changed fundamentally after Sridevi's death, saying she lost the specific 'version of him' that existed when her mother was alive.
Beyond the superstar persona, Janhvi expressed a deep longing for Sridevi’s humour and the way she anchored the family. She noted that there is truly 'no one like her' and the void left behind continues to shape her, her sister Khushi, and their father.
